(2019-01-27, 19:14)ronie Wrote: since way too many users are having issues with this tool, and it is obviously not being maintained anymore, i'll mark this thread as broken.

now for the good news, you don't need this tool at all!
the images for pretty much every skin can be downloaded from their github repo.

HOWTO

1) open the addon.xml file of the skin you're interested in and you should see a line like this:
xml:
<source>https://github.com/Tgxcorporation/skin.chroma</source>

2) go to that web address, select the branch that matches your kodi version and hit the download button
Image



you'll now have a copy of the skin with all the images unpacked!
